Configuration Profile Installation
A configuration profile, obtained from Apple’s developer portal or public beta program website, is generally a prerequisite for receiving beta updates. This profile identifies the device as authorized to receive pre-release software. Failure to correctly install the configuration profile will prevent the device from recognizing and downloading the “how to ios 18 beta” update. For instance, attempting to update via the Software Update section in Settings without the profile installed will result in the device indicating that the software is up to date, effectively blocking the beta installation.
-
Software Update via Settings
Once the configuration profile is properly installed, the “how to ios 18 beta” update becomes available through the standard Software Update mechanism within the device’s Settings application. This process involves navigating to Settings > General > Software Update, where the beta update should appear. The update is then downloaded and installed in a manner similar to standard iOS updates. Interruption of this process, such as through loss of internet connectivity or insufficient battery power, can lead to a corrupted installation and require a restore to a previous version of iOS.
-
Sufficient Storage Space
Adequate free storage space on the target device is essential for a successful “how to ios 18 beta” installation. The update package can be several gigabytes in size, and the installation process requires additional temporary storage. Insufficient storage space will result in an installation failure, potentially leaving the device in an unstable state. Prior to initiating the update, it is advisable to free up at least 10GB of storage by removing unnecessary files, applications, and media.
-
Stable Network Connection
A reliable and stable network connection, preferably Wi-Fi, is paramount for downloading the “how to ios 18 beta” update. Intermittent or weak connections can lead to incomplete downloads and corrupted installation files. Such interruptions may necessitate restarting the download process or, in severe cases, restoring the device to a previous state. A strong and consistent Wi-Fi signal minimizes the risk of these complications and ensures a smooth update process.

Restoring from Backup
Restoring from a previously created backup represents the primary and recommended Uninstallation Method for “how to ios 18 beta.” This process involves utilizing either iCloud or a local computer-based backup to revert the device to its state prior to installing the beta software. For instance, if a user experiences widespread application incompatibility or persistent system instability after installing “how to ios 18 beta,” restoring from a backup allows them to return to the stable version of iOS without losing personal data. The efficacy of this method underscores the importance of creating a comprehensive backup before participating in any beta program, as it serves as the ultimate safety net in case of unforeseen issues.
-
DFU Mode Recovery
Device Firmware Update (DFU) mode offers a more forceful Uninstallation Method for cases where the device becomes unresponsive or experiences critical boot failures after attempting “how to ios 18 beta.” DFU mode allows the device to communicate directly with iTunes (or Finder on newer macOS versions) without loading the operating system. This allows for a clean restore to the latest publicly available version of iOS. However, it is important to note that DFU mode recovery typically results in complete data loss unless a separate backup is available. Therefore, it should be considered a last resort when other Uninstallation Methods fail to resolve the issue.
-
Removing the Beta Profile
Removing the beta profile is a necessary step in preventing further beta updates and transitioning back to the standard update channel. Once a user decides to discontinue participation in “how to ios 18 beta,” removing the installed beta profile ensures that the device no longer receives pre-release software. This step, typically performed within the device’s Settings menu, is crucial for avoiding unintended updates to future beta versions. While removing the profile does not uninstall the currently installed beta software, it prevents further iterations from being automatically downloaded and installed, paving the way for a return to the public release.
-
Waiting for the Official Release
A passive, yet viable, Uninstallation Method involves simply waiting for the official public release of the iOS version being tested in the beta program. Once the final version is released, the device will receive a standard Software Update notification, allowing the user to transition from the beta to the official release. This approach avoids the need for manual restoration or DFU mode recovery. However, it requires patience and acceptance of any potential instability or issues present in the beta software until the official release becomes available. It’s a practical option for users who are comfortable with the beta environment but wish to eventually return to the stable public build.

Question 1: What are the prerequisites for installing iOS 18 beta?
Installation necessitates either an Apple Developer Program membership or enrollment in the Apple Beta Software Program. A compatible device, as specified by Apple, is also required. Furthermore, sufficient technical proficiency is advisable to troubleshoot potential issues.
Question 2: How can a device be enrolled in the iOS 18 beta program?
Enrollment involves installing a configuration profile provided by Apple, either through the Developer portal or the Beta Software Program website. This profile authorizes the device to receive beta updates via the Software Update mechanism in Settings.
Question 3: What risks are associated with running iOS 18 beta?
Potential risks include system instability, application incompatibility, data loss, and exposure to security vulnerabilities. Beta software is inherently unstable and may contain unresolved bugs that can impact device functionality.
Question 4: Is it possible to revert to a previous iOS version after installing iOS 18 beta?
Reversion is possible by restoring the device from a backup created before installing the beta software. If a backup is unavailable, Device Firmware Update (DFU) mode can be used, but data loss is probable.
Question 5: How does one submit feedback to Apple regarding iOS 18 beta?
Feedback can be submitted through the Feedback Assistant application, typically included with beta software. Detailed bug reports, feature suggestions, and performance evaluations are valuable contributions.
Question 6: Will all applications be compatible with iOS 18 beta?
Compatibility is not guaranteed. Some applications may experience functionality issues or crashes due to incompatibilities with the beta software. It is advisable to verify the compatibility of critical applications before installing the beta.
